Transaction 32a544c72c3958a7be17ae431668cb39711b560f776bd1b89c7f719134960797
1 Input
1 Output
-
32a544c72c3958a7be17ae431668cb39711b560f776bd1b89c7f719134960797:0
- value
- 39383
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9a2dfc7138acafd064668f3e53698b48e88980f
- address
- bc1qex3dl3cn3t906pjxdre72d5ckj8g3xq02a3sgp